Zaha asked to leave - Pardew

Saturday, August 27 2016 by SNTV
  • Crystal Palace manager Alan Pardew spoke on Friday (26th August) ahead of the visit of Bournemouth in the English Premier League.

    SOUNDBITE: (English) Alan Pardew, Crystal Palace manager:

    (On Crystal Palace rejecting a bid for Wilfred Zaha from Tottenham Hotspur):

    "Well, Zaha said if he could see me and said he believed there was some interest from Tottenham Hotspur and may he go. I said I'll have to see what that bid is, Wilfred and I'll have to speak to the chairman. We didn't instigate the transfer, we never put his name out there as we did with Yannick Bolasie, I never put their names out there for transfer. So, I think the chairman's put the full stop on that deal and I think that's the right for us because we've made a lot of changes already and he was our player of the year last year and terrific and a fans favourite here. So, (we're) very keen to keep him."

    SOUNDBITE: (English) Alan Pardew, Crystal Palace manager:

    (On their match against Bournemouth):

    "No, I think that it's an important game for both clubs because we don't want to be rooted at the bottom with zero points after three games. But, we're going through changes to the team, to the squad because we want to put right the second half of our season last year. We are in the process of doing that, a bit slower than I would like, but that's the market I'm afraid
